Position Summary:

The Population and Development (P&D) Specialist is located in the China Country Office (CO) and reports to the UNFPA Deputy Representative.

The P&D Specialist ensures the effective management of UNFPA activities in the areas of population and development with a focus on integration of population dynamics considerations into national and subnational development planning and strategies, and advancing policies on ageing, urbanization and migration that are supportive of the International Conference on Population and Development (ICPD) Agenda and Agenda 2030 and related South-South and triangular cooperation (SSTC) initiatives. S/he leads project formulation and evaluation, joint programming initiatives and national development frameworks. S/he leads the P&D programme team and collaborates with the CO’s operations/administrative support staff.
